3 % by volume in a Diesel engine is "EXCESSIVE" and will dilute the oil, so the Viscosity is affected. When the Viscosity lowers by 2 SAE/ISO grades, the oil should be changed! Soot will not lower the Viscosity, but it will increase the Viscosity.
If I had 3% fuel dilution im my oil, I would get it out, and find out why the fuel is getting in the oil. Fuel contamination is definately going to increase wear in the engine.
